Does solar PV have a trade pattern in East Asia?
Yang et al. (2017) displayed changes in solar PV’s core-periphery hierarchical trade patterns in East Asia. Based on previous results, Guan et al. (2020) proposed functional trade patterns, the optimal trade patterns measured and determined by network motifs, to estimate the potential PV trade flows effectively.

How does China's Photovoltaic Industry Innovation Network evolve?
Innovation ability and organizational proximity play key roles in the evolution of China's photovoltaic industry innovation network. The innovation network is the frontier of economic geography, although the drivers and the underlying mechanism of the evolution of this innovation network are not clear.
